Abstract
The stratiform and vein base metal sulfide mineralization of the Evros region has been emplaced during three major metallogenetic periods: the Pre-, Early- and Mid-Alpidic orogenic era. The Pre-Alpidic mineralization is associated with a metamorphosed ophiolitic mafic-ultramafic sequence (Rhodope Massif), the EarlyAlpidic with tholeiitic metabasalt (Circum Rhodope Belt) and the Mid-Alpidic mineralization has its major development in Tertiary sedimentary and calc-alkaline igneous rocks.
These types of mineralization, depending on their geotectonic setting, are considered to be similar to that of the Limassol Forest Plutonic Complex (Rhodope Massif), to volcanic-exhalative and analogous to Cyprus volcanogenic massive sulfides (Circum Rhodope Belt), and to stratiform sediment hosted and veins of volcanic affiliation (Tertiary volcano-sedimentary basins).
